Gravel pothole filling services involve repairing and restoring damaged or uneven areas of gravel driveways, parking lots, and other gravel surfaces. This process typically includes removing loose or deteriorated gravel, leveling the surface, and filling in potholes or ruts with fresh gravel. The goal is to create a smoother, more stable surface that can better withstand regular use and weather conditions. These services are essential for maintaining the functionality and appearance of gravel surfaces, preventing further deterioration, and ensuring safety for vehicles and pedestrians.

Potholes and uneven patches in gravel surfaces can lead to a variety of problems, including increased wear on vehicles, difficulty in driving or walking, and potential safety hazards. Water can seep into cracks and holes, causing erosion and further damage over time. Without timely repairs, small potholes can grow larger, making the surface unsafe and more costly to fix later. Gravel pothole filling services help address these issues by quickly restoring the surface, reducing the risk of accidents, and extending the lifespan of the gravel area.

The overview below groups typical Gravel Pothole Filling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gallatin,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gravel pothole repairs in Gallatin and nearby areas range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and depth of the potholes.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Moderate Fixes - For larger, more extensive gravel pothole repairs, local contractors generally char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ects often involve multiple potholes or sections of damaged gravel, which are common in the area.

Full Pothole Refill - Complete filling and leveling of severely damaged gravel surfaces typically costs between $1,200 and $2,500.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for maintaining long-term road quality.

Full Replacement - When gravel surfaces require full replacement due to extensive deterioration, costs can range from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this range, especially for extensive driveways or parking are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are gravel pothole filling services? Gravel pothole filling services involve using gravel and other materials to repair and fill potholes in driveways, roads, or parking lots to restore surface smoothness and safety.

Why should I consider gravel for pothole repairs? Gravel is a practical choice because it provides a durable, cost-effective, and quick solution for filling potholes,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the surface.

How do local contractors typically perform gravel pothole repairs? Local service providers usually excavate the damaged area, clean out debris, and then fill the pothole with gravel, compacting it to ensure stability and longevity.

Are gravel pothole repairs suitable for all types of surfaces? Gravel repairs are most effective on unpaved surfaces like gravel driveways or parking areas, but may be used as a temporary fix on paved surfaces until more permanent repairs are made.
